AI语音开发套件进阶:优化语音识别准确率
在人工智能飞速发展的今天,语音识别技术已经深入到我们生活的方方面面。从智能家居、智能客服到自动驾驶,语音识别技术都扮演着至关重要的角色。然而,如何提高语音识别的准确率,成为了一个亟待解决的问题。本文将讲述一位AI语音开发者的故事,他通过不断探索和实践,成功地将AI语音开发套件推向了新的高度。
这位AI语音开发者名叫李明,从小就对计算机和人工智能充满了浓厚的兴趣。大学毕业后,他进入了一家知名互联网公司,从事语音识别算法的研究。在工作中,他逐渐发现,虽然语音识别技术已经取得了很大的进步,但在实际应用中,准确率仍然存在很大的提升空间。
为了提高语音识别的准确率,李明开始研究各种优化方法。他了解到,影响语音识别准确率的因素有很多,包括噪声干扰、方言口音、说话人差异等。为了解决这些问题,他开始尝试从以下几个方面进行优化:
一、数据增强
李明首先关注的是数据增强。他发现,传统的语音数据集往往规模较小,且缺乏多样性。为了解决这个问题,他尝试从以下几个方面进行数据增强:
扩展数据集:他收集了大量的语音数据,包括不同场景、不同说话人、不同方言等,使数据集更加丰富。
数据变换:通过对原始数据进行时域、频域变换,增加数据的多样性。
数据合成:利用语音合成技术,生成与真实语音数据相似的合成数据,进一步扩充数据集。
二、模型优化
在模型优化方面,李明主要从以下几个方面入手:
模型选择:他尝试了多种语音识别模型,如HMM、DTW、MFCC等,并最终选择了性能较好的模型。
模型参数调整:通过对模型参数进行优化,提高模型的泛化能力。
模型融合:将多个模型进行融合,取长补短,提高整体性能。
三、前端处理优化
前端处理是语音识别过程中的重要环节,李明针对前端处理进行了以下优化:
噪声抑制:采用噪声抑制技术,降低噪声对语音识别的影响。
频率滤波:对语音信号进行频率滤波,去除干扰成分。
预处理:对语音信号进行预处理,如静音检测、音量归一化等,提高后续处理的效果。
四、后端处理优化
后端处理主要包括解码和说话人识别等任务。李明针对后端处理进行了以下优化:
解码算法优化:采用更高效的解码算法,提高解码速度和准确率。
说话人识别优化:采用说话人识别技术,降低说话人差异对语音识别的影响。
经过一系列的优化,李明的AI语音开发套件在准确率上取得了显著的提升。他的套件被广泛应用于智能家居、智能客服、教育等领域,受到了广大用户的一致好评。
然而,李明并没有满足于此。他深知,语音识别技术还有很大的发展空间。为了进一步提高准确率,他开始关注以下方面:
一、跨语言语音识别
随着全球化的发展,跨语言语音识别成为了一个新的研究方向。李明计划研究如何将不同语言的语音识别技术进行融合,实现跨语言语音识别。
二、情感语音识别
情感语音识别是语音识别技术的一个重要应用方向。李明希望研究如何从语音信号中提取情感信息,为情感分析、心理咨询等领域提供技术支持。
三、多模态语音识别
多模态语音识别是未来语音识别技术的一个重要发展方向。李明计划研究如何将语音信号与其他模态(如图像、文本)进行融合,实现更全面、更准确的语音识别。
总之,李明通过不断探索和实践,将AI语音开发套件推向了新的高度。他的故事告诉我们,只有勇于创新、不断探索,才能在人工智能领域取得更大的突破。相信在不久的将来,语音识别技术将会为我们的生活带来更多的便利。
猜你喜欢:人工智能对话